Looking to ace your upcoming academic year? As an NBCUniversal Academic Year intern, you'll work on real projects, be part of our collaborative culture, and get the support you need to grow - across two full semesters. Our Internship Program is all about impact, giving you the chance to contribute to meaningful work while building skills that matter. If you're curious, driven, and excited about media, entertainment, and technology, we provide an environment designed to help you learn and grow every day.


In addition to all of our internships being paid, we will also offer the following for our Academic Year interns:

  • Paid time off for mental health, academic exams, and personal holidays.
  • Robust networking, learning and professional development opportunities.
  • Complimentary Peacock subscription for the duration of the internship.
  • Free admission to Universal Parks to use during your internship.
  • Access to mental health resources, including counseling sessions.
Academic Year Internship Program Details


Program Dates: September 21, 2026 - April 23, 2027


Time Commitment: 16-24 hours per week. Exact schedule to be determined based on business need. We will do our best to accommodate course schedules.


Format: Opportunities listed will require an intern to work from Universal City, CA.

Operations & Technology: (O&T) is a $1B operating cash flow ($1.5B FCF) division of NBCUniversal. The group functions as a global shared service within NBCUniversal performing critical functions including Media, Broadcast and Studio Operations & Production, Content Supply Chain, Information Technology and Engineering, as well as Cyber Security. The group operates from numerous locations around the world, including New York, New Jersey, Los Angeles, Denver, Connecticut, and London.

Qualifications

Basic Requirements:
  • Must be actively enrolled in a degree-granting program at an accredited institution during the entire duration of the program (September 2026 through April 2027). December 2026 graduates are not eligible for this Academic Year Internship Program.
  • Current class standing of sophomore or above (30 credits).
  • Must be presently authorized to work for any employer in the United States and must not require work visa sponsorship from NBCUniversal now or in the future to retain authorization to work in the United States.
  • Must be available to work 16-24 hours per week from September 21, 2026 - April 23, 2027.
  • Must be willing to work in Universal City, CA.
For further clarification, candidates currently on any student or exchange visa (e.g. F-1 CPT, F-1 OPT, J-1, M-1) are not eligible to apply unless they will be able to change or adjust to another status that grants work authorization without NBCUniversal sponsorship.


NBCUniversal is an E-Verify company, requiring all employees to have an active Social Security number. Any candidate receiving an internship offer must complete I-9 form with Social Security number within 3 days of hire.


Desired Characteristics:
  • Students with class standing of junior or above preferred.
  • Cumulative GPA of 3.0 or above.
  • Previous history and understanding of security in any capacity as a plus knowledge of the media entertainment work closed is also a plus.
  • General understanding of computer skills and technology ecosystem tied to the media entertainment environment.
The hourly rate for student interns is $40.00.
